Ashland Sustainability Committee approves Skip the Stuff bylaw framework. Chair Ashwin Ratanchandani and the committee voted to exclude mandatory restaurant signage and enforcement penalties from a draft ordinance modeled on Wellesley's rule, with Sustainability Project Manager Sam Riley recommending continued Board of Health engagement during implementation. The committee approved a six-month grace period for restaurants and agreed to pursue an April 26 Earth Day event.

Cara Hulme is developing a Sustainable Building Best Practices training resource; the committee approved adding Elham as an official member and voted unanimously to accept February 19 minutes.
